What is the Access Request Form for Protected Health Information?
The Access Request Form for Protected Health Information is a critical document that allows individuals to request access to their personal health information (PHI) maintained by healthcare facilities in Missouri. This form not only facilitates the retrieval of medical records but also ensures compliance with HIPAA regulations, which mandate that patients have the right to access their medical information.
Understanding the significance of accessing personal health information is essential as it empowers patients to manage their health effectively and maintain continuity of care. The access request form plays a pivotal role in helping users navigate their rights under HIPAA, ensuring that their requests for PHI are processed appropriately.
Purpose and Benefits of Using the Access Request Form for Protected Health Information
Utilizing the Access Request Form for Protected Health Information offers several advantages for patients and their families. First, it provides a formalized method to obtain medical records, which is crucial for continuity of care or personal documentation.
Moreover, patients gain insights into their health history, helping them make informed decisions about their healthcare. By understanding their rights under HIPAA, individuals can advocate for themselves in instances where access to their information is delayed or denied.
Who Can Use the Access Request Form for Protected Health Information?
The Access Request Form can be utilized by various individuals, including patients themselves, parents, legal guardians, and legal representatives. Each of these roles has specific responsibilities in the request process, and signatures are typically required to validate the form.
For instance, a parent may need to act on behalf of a minor, while legal representatives may be required in scenarios where the patient is incapacitated. It's important to understand these roles to ensure proper access to health information.
How to Fill Out the Access Request Form for Protected Health Information
Completing the Access Request Form involves several critical steps to ensure the accuracy and efficiency of your request:
-
Start by filling in your personal identification details accurately.
-
Describe the specific records you wish to access clearly.
-
Complete all required fields, ensuring no sections are left blank.
-
Attach any additional documentation that may be necessary.
-
Sign and date the form as required.
Following these instructions carefully can reduce the chances of delays in processing your request.
Submission Methods for the Access Request Form for Protected Health Information
Once you have completed the Access Request Form, there are multiple submission methods available:
-
Online submission via the healthcare facility's secure portal, if applicable.
-
Mailing the completed form to the designated address provided by the healthcare facility.
-
In-person submission at the facility for immediate processing.
Be sure to check the specific timelines for submitting the form, as these can vary by facility.
Fees and Processing Time for the Access Request Form
Accessing your PHI may incur some costs, typically associated with copying or summarizing the records requested. It's essential to inquire about these fees beforehand to avoid unexpected charges.
Processing times for your request can differ based on the policies of the healthcare facility, so understanding these timeframes helps set expectations. In some cases, fee waivers are available for eligible individuals, which can significantly reduce costs.
What Happens After You Submit the Access Request Form for Protected Health Information
After submitting the Access Request Form, you can expect to receive a confirmation of receipt from the healthcare facility. This confirmation serves as a record that your request has been acknowledged.
Tracking the status of your request is usually possible through the healthcare facility’s designated contact methods. Outcomes of your request can range from approval to denial, with clear communication from the facility regarding next steps.

Who is eligible to fill out the Access Request Form?
Patients, parents or legal guardians of minor patients, and legally authorized representatives can fill out the Access Request Form for Protected Health Information.
What supporting documents are needed with the form?
Typically, you should include identification details and any documents that verify your relationship to the patient, such as guardianship papers if applicable.
How do I submit the completed Access Request Form?
You can submit the completed form directly to the healthcare facility by following their specific submission method, whether it’s via mail, fax, or in-person delivery.
What should I do if my request for information access is denied?
If access is denied, the healthcare facility is required to provide a written explanation. You can discuss this with them and consider appealing the decision based on HIPAA regulations.
Are there any fees associated with accessing health information?
Yes, healthcare facilities may charge a fee for copying or summarizing health information requested through the form. Be sure to ask about potential costs upfront.
How long does it take to process an Access Request?
Processing times can vary by facility, but healthcare providers are typically required to respond to access requests within 30 days.
What mistakes should I avoid when filling out the form?
Ensure all fields are accurately completed, follow the signing requirements, and attach any necessary documents before submission to avoid processing delays.
